Springmaid Pier: The Perfect Date Destination in Myrtle Beach
Nestled in the heart of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, Springmaid Pier offers a timeless coastal charm that makes it an exceptional place for couples seeking a memorable and meaningful date. Stretching 1,060 feet into the Atlantic Ocean, this iconic pier is not only the longest in Myrtle Beach but also a vibrant hub of experiences that blend relaxation, adventure, and romance effortlessly.

What Couples Can Do Together
Springmaid Pier caters to a variety of interests, making it easy to tailor your date to your shared passions. Here are some delightful activities to enjoy:
-
Fishing Together: For couples who love a bit of adventure or want to try something new, fishing off the pier is a rewarding pastime. The pier is well-stocked for anglers, with FISHTAILS offering bait, tackle, and gear for rent or purchase. Trying your luck at catching local fish species adds a fun, interactive element to your date.
-
Casual Dining with a View: When hunger strikes, Southern Tides Bar & Grill awaits right on the pier with a welcoming atmosphere and delicious eats. Enjoy fresh seafood, flavorful drinks, and casual fare while soaking in ocean views through large windows or at outdoor seating. When to Visit
Springmaid Pier is open daily from early morning until late evening, offering flexibility in planning your date. Early mornings provide a tranquil, almost private experience with soft light and calm waters—ideal for couples who like peaceful starts. Afternoons bring vibrant activity, with families and visitors enjoying the space, which can add a lively energy if you prefer a more dynamic backdrop.
That said, the magic truly unfolds at sunset. Arriving about an hour before dusk lets you explore the pier and find a cozy spot for your perfect sunset view. Evening visits are also great for grabbing dinner or drinks at Southern Tides and lingering as the pier lights twinkle against the night sky.
